When she was in her 20s, Marina Chello signed a label deal and released a series of singles.
But when her career failed to take off, she wound up stepping away from music for a while to start a family.
She showed up on The Voice stage eager to give music a second chance. Now she’s looking forward to releasing her first new music in more than 10 years.
Marina, 37, of Plainview, N.Y., turned two chairs with her blind audition to land a spot on Team Blake Shelton and was so impressive in the battle round that Blake decided to save her.
She was eliminated in a knockout round match that aired this week, though she received nothing but praise for her performance of “I Who Have Nothing.”
Here’s what the native of Uzbekistan told Voice Views about her time on the show and her plans for new music.
Voice Views: What do you consider your biggest takeaway / lesson learned from The Voice experience?
Marina Chello: To never stop believing in myself, never stop going after my dreams, and to always stay true to myself — that way I never question my decisions and actions.
Voice Views: The battles and knockouts were filmed over the summer. What have you been doing musically since then and where are you hoping The Voice experience leads?
Marina Chello: I’ve been gigging a lot and writing songs. I’ve also been trying to figure out who I want to work with since there have been people reaching out to work with me. I’m going to have new music out soon and can’t wait to release it.
Voice Views: Can you tell me about that — the new music — what you’re planning, what fans can expert in terms of sound and the timetable for doing so?
Marina Chello: I believe with the show I’ve learned what my true sound is. I’ve always sung many different genres of music, but I believe the pop-rock/soul is where my voice sounds best so I’m writing a lot and have a ton of material from the past that I never had the chance to record. I’m excited to release new music as it’s been way too long
Voice Views: Is there anything else you’d like to add about The Voice experience?
Marina Chello: Just that I’m truly grateful to The Voice for giving me this platform. I’ve learned so much, I’ve met amazing people, and I’ve worked with and got mentored by superstars of today’s industry. I’d also like to thank everyone from all over the world that reached out. There’s been such an outpouring love and support for my “I Who Have Nothing” performance, and I’m truly humbled and honored I got to sing a Tom Jones song and have it be received the way it is. Thank you.
